The iron curtain refers to the line that separated the Soviet satellite states of eastern Europe from western Europe. The term "iron curtain" was chosen to describe the degree of separation that existed between Communist and non-Communist states in Europe and to describe the repression and force by the USSR in the establishment of its sphere of influence. <span>I think that western leaders were so concerned about the Iron Curtain because it represented the Soviet Union's continued desire to expand, the threat of war with the Soviet Union, and the overall threat of Communism.</span>

Black codes were enacted right after the Civil War.
Explanation:
Black Codes were laws created by former Confederate states after the Civil War to weaken the status of blacks in those states. Laws began to be created in 1865 with the passage of the 13th Amendment to the Constitution in the United States, which officially liberated all black slaves.
Black Codes had time to be created for more than a year before Congress, with a Republican party opposed to slavery in the majority, passed the Civil Rights Act and the 14th and 15th Amendments to the Constitution. In the late 1870s, however, the position of blacks weakened again as racist extremism, led by the Ku Klux Klan, intensified.
